Like the Car
I boughth this car as a cheap 4-door car that got decent gas mileage because of my commute. It has lived up to all of those expectations and "knock-on- wood" has been the most reliable car I have ever had.

Good car
Got this car in January and chose this over the Mitsubishi Eclipse because of handling and fuel economy. The car hasnt let me down yet and it appears it wont. This car is manufactured actually in Japan unlike the civic which is made in the good ole' USA and the sentra which is assembled in Mexico. So this is actually an import with japanease quality.
